DETERMINATION OF GLYPHOSATE IN SOIL USING HIGH-PERFORMANCE LIQUID CHROMATOGRAPHY

Abstract

The determination of glyphosate in soils is of great interest due to the widespread use of this herbicide and the need of assessing its impact on the soil. However, its residue determination is very problematic especially in soils with high organic matter content, where strong interferences are normally observed, and because of the particular physico-chemical characteristics of this polar/ionic herbicide. In this article, we improved the methodology for the analytical determination of high performance liquid chromatography using UV detectors of the widespread glyphosate herbicide used in large areas for soy or corn, including among other crops in the foothills of South -East Kazakhstan. The determination of glyphosate by the developed method can be considered as a simple, fast, efficient and sensitive method for routine analysis of this compound in soil samples that uses minimal sample handling.
